Course Content

• Linear Systems Analysis
• Stability Criteria (Routh-Hurwitz, Nyquist)
• Root Locus Techniques
• Frequency Response Analysis (Bode, Nyquist plots)
• Control System Design for Stability
• State-Space Representation and Stability
• Nonlinear Systems and Stability Analysis
• Advanced Control System Stability Analysis (e.g., Lyapunov Stability)
